async batchRequestWithType<T>(
requests: RpcParams[],
isT: (val: any) => val is T
): Promise<T[]> {
const responses = await this.batchRequest(requests);
// TODO: supports other error modes such as throw or return
const validResponses = responses.filter(
(response: any) => isValidResponse(response) && isT(response.result)
);

return validResponses.map((response: ValidResponse) => response.result);
}

async batchRequest(requests: RpcParams[]): Promise<any> {
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
// Do nothing if requests is empty
if (requests.length === 0) resolve([]);

const batch = requests.map(params => {
return this.rpcClient.request(params.method, params.args);
});

this.rpcClient.request(batch, (err: any, response: any) => {
if (err) {
reject(err);
return;
}
resolve(response);
});
});
}
